Imagine Bridal Teams Up With Forevermark

Imagine_Designs.jpg

Imagine Bridal will collaborate with Forevermark Diamonds on a new collection of wedding jewelry that will be available exclusively to authorized Forevermark retailers, according to a press release.

“The Imagine Bridal and Forevermark partnership brings together two brands with the same common vision,” said Brian Hakimian, president of Imagine Bridal. “We will hand-craft and design classic heirloom jewelry with Forevermark diamonds that have been hand selected for their beauty, and we will distribute our collections with the help of our Forevermark retail partners.”

The Imagine Bridal Forevermark collection will feature uniquely designed anniversary bands, eternity bands, engagement rings, pendants, and earrings.

Stuller Launches Version 5 of CounterSketch Studio

Stuller CounterSketch Studio version 5

Jewelry manufacturer Stuller and technology solutions company Gemvision are bringing jewelry design software into the future with the fifth installment of CounterSketch Studio.

Version 5 of the jewelry design software offers access to new technology such as 3-D printing design models, the ability to create a custom design around a specific diamond, and exact pricing for pieces created with CounterSketch Studio, all of which can be done right on the sales floor.

“We’ve enhanced the custom-design experience to a new level with version 5,” said Jeff High, president of Gemvision and chief innovation officer for Stuller. “Now through the Project 3D Printer, jewelers have the opportunity to print a resin model right from the software and present customers with a tangible version of their unique design.”

Charles Garnier Paris Releases New Hearts and Arrows Catalog

Charles Garnier Hearts and Arrows Diamond collection
Charles Garnier Paris focuses exclusively on Hearts and Arrows Diamonds in its latest collection of sterling silver jewelry. The company is also using faceted gemstones in 10 different colors, including blue topaz, amethyst, and lapis lazuli. This is the first time in the United States that a company is exclusively using Hearts and Arrows with sterling silver jewelry, according to a press release.

“The response has been excellent and our customers, based mostly of independents, love the opportunity to differentiate themselves from the chains,” said Julie Franco, vice president of sales. “The quality and the cut of our diamonds make all the difference.”
